Engaging with Clay

in creative early childhood education

We are hosting a day dedicated to clay inspired by Reggio Children’s new publicationClay – techniques, experiences, imaginaries’. The day will comprise:

  • Practical explorations of clay within an environment of enquiry and meaning-making;
  • Examples of projects involving the medium of clay from Early Years /Primary settings in the UK;
  • Exploring possibilities for constructing encounters with clay for children;
  • Reflections on working with children's ideas to "co-construct" educational projects and the implications for early childhood/Primary pedagogy.

It is designed for educators, heads and managers in public, private and voluntary settings who are keen to evolve their creative, reflective practice.

The day will also be the foundation for an optional supported online learning group September – November 2026, in which participants will develop and share their practice.
